RUSSELL MARTIN has urged national unity to haul Scotland back from the World Cup brink.

The Norwich defender is desperate for the country to pull together in a bid to stay alive in the section.

Around 20,000 seats could be lying empty at Hampden for the must-win crunch clash.

Just over 9000 witnessed the midweek friendly against Canada at Easter Road but Martin is desperate for a passionate home audience to try to fill the National Stadium and roar the Tartan troops to a much-needed triumph.

He said: “We’ve got a big game and everyone needs to be together. Fans, staff, players, media, everyone needs to be positive towards Sunday so we get a result.

“It helps to have a full house behind you, we’ll do as well as we possibly can and stick to the game plan the manager sets out for us.

Scotland must to win to stay in the qualificat­ion hunt and Martin added: “There are no easy games in this group, England have found that going away to Slovenia already.

“But there are points available, this is the kind of group where teams will all take points off each other.
